Output 25fce48963d48b430026aa4261a6eb1c40ba89a0508afcc5d1915a17c34a8785:4

value
995366
script pubkey
OP_0 OP_PUSHBYTES_20 d51f7a85290bcc6e63dd1395eec9ceebfb131103
address
ltc1q650h4pffp0xxuc7azw27ajwwa0a3xygrlzyhzj
transaction
25fce48963d48b430026aa4261a6eb1c40ba89a0508afcc5d1915a17c34a8785
spent
true